Fooling the eye: trompe l’oeil porcelain in High Qing China
Porcelain imitation of other materials, or so-called ‘trompe l'oeil’ porcelain, popular from the late Yongzheng to the Qianlong period, has been regarded as an aesthetic representative of Chinese emperors as well as an iconography of court power.
